However, before you apply for an instant personal loan in India, make sure these 4 things:

1. Interest rates

The new-age financial institutions charge you interest rates along with the personal loan amount; however, these interest rates are different for every bank and NBFC (Non-Banking Financial Company). Thus, you must always check and compare amongst financial institutions to find the bank or NBFC (Non-Banking Financial Company) providing you with the lowest interest rates.

2. Repayment tenure

As discussed earlier, one of the biggest benefits of opting for an instant personal loan online is the flexible repayment tenure provided along with the loan product. However, the longer your repayment tenure, the higher your interest rates. Thus, always choose the financial institution that provides you with your choice of repayment tenure at the lowest rates of interest.

3. Processing fees and other charges

Interest rates are not the only charges that you have to pay along with your instant personal loan online; after all, financial companies also charge you additional charges. These additional charges are in the form of processing fees, prepayment charges, and late payment fees.

4. Your eligibility criteria

Now that you have compared and finalized your financial institution, ensure that you check your eligibility criteria. After all, every bank and NBFC (Non-Banking Financial Company) has their own set of eligibility criteria that you must fulfil to be able to borrow from them. Further, every financial institution has its own unique set of eligibility criteria; thus, ensure that you check the eligibility criteria with your choice of bank or NBFC (Non-Banking Financial Company). The most common eligibility criteria are your credit score, credit history, income source, age, documentation, etc.
